Why Choose an Android TV?
So, why go for an Android TV in the first place? Well, the Android TV operating system is a game-changer. It’s like having a giant tablet on your wall! You get access to the Google Play Store, which means you can download thousands of apps, from streaming services like Netflix, Amazon Prime Video, and Disney+ to games and even productivity tools. The flexibility is insane! Plus, Android TV integrates seamlessly with other Google services. You can cast content from your phone or tablet using Chromecast built-in, control your TV with Google Assistant, and even manage your smart home devices right from your TV screen. It's all about convenience and connectivity. Forget about juggling multiple remotes or dealing with clunky interfaces. Android TV is designed to be user-friendly and intuitive, making it easy for anyone to navigate and enjoy their favorite content. And with regular updates, you can be sure that your TV will stay up-to-date with the latest features and security enhancements. Things to Consider Before Buying
Before you click that "buy" button, let's quickly run through some things to consider before buying. It's not just about the price; you want to make sure you're getting the best value for your money. First, think about the screen size. How big is your room, and how far away will you be sitting from the TV? A larger screen can be immersive, but it can also be overwhelming in a small space. Next, consider the picture quality. Look for features like HDR and 4K resolution, which can significantly enhance your viewing experience. But don't get too caught up in the specs; sometimes, the best way to judge picture quality is to see the TV in person. Audio quality is another important factor. While most TVs come with built-in speakers, they're often not the best. Consider investing in a soundbar or external speakers for a more immersive audio experience. And finally, think about the smart features. Do you want access to streaming apps like Netflix and Amazon Prime Video? Do you want voice control with Google Assistant? Make sure the TV has the features that are important to you. By considering these factors, you can be sure that you're making the right choice and getting the best smart Android TV for your needs.
